5058578
3231769
689608
42175544
56625928
8396360
88577
84464996
75303487
20727444
12249368
48159705
42011609
89121777
18389
84037773
1723100
60589770
58463667
3235908
63186302
9079734
44069632
80362491
87343744
23568677
80415336
15784571
53403189
17732837
43367458
328473
4731689
43438214
69459663
45839239
83228792
3841261
49752935
26733016